Team Lead IT Support
Pin-Up Global is looking for a Team Lead IT Support to manage and coordinate a team of IT Support Engineers across multiple international office locations. The role focuses on ensuring high-quality IT service delivery, maintaining operational excellence, and driving process improvements within a fast-paced, multicultural environment.
The successful candidate will oversee team performance, resource allocation, and the lifecycle management of corporate hardware and workplace technologies. This position requires a balance of technical expertise in Windows and macOS administration, strong leadership capabilities, and the ability to collaborate effectively with various internal stakeholders to support the company's growing infrastructure.
- Lead and coordinate a team of 6–7 IT Support Engineers across 2-3 locations.
- Organize team workload, priorities, and resource allocation to ensure efficient support operations.
- Ensure high-quality IT support services by maintaining SLA compliance and continuously improving service delivery.
- Coordinate onboarding and offboarding activities, ensuring timely provisioning of workplace equipment and user readiness.
- Organize and oversee the rollout of corporate systems and workplace technologies at the end-user and device level.
- Ensure continuous availability of standardized hardware through procurement planning, inventory management, and vendor coordination.
- Drive hardware standardization, asset inventory accuracy, and full hardware lifecycle management.
- Develop, maintain, and improve IT Support documentation, operational procedures, and user-facing knowledge base articles.
- Collaborate with Infrastructure, Information Security, HR, Procurement, Workplace, and other internal stakeholders to improve IT services and operational efficiency.
- Monitor team performance, conduct regular 1:1 meetings, support employee development, participate in hiring, onboarding, and performance reviews.
- Identify opportunities for process optimization, automation, and standardization across supported locations.
- Prepare operational reports and provide regular updates on service quality, risks, and improvement initiatives.

PIN-UP Global is an international holding company that develops technologies, B2B solutions and products for the iGaming industry. Headquartered in Warsaw, the group brings together businesses spanning product development, technology and marketing services for online gaming. It supports a portfolio of companies and brands operating across multiple markets. PIN-UP Global focuses on building advanced technology and products for the gambling sector.
